About

Ryan Abbott, M.D., J.D., M.T.O.M., is Professor of Law and Health Sciences at the University of Surrey School of Law and Adjunct Assistant Professor of Medicine at the David Geffen School of Medicine at UCLA. He is highly regarded for his scholarship, teaching, and professional activities related to global health issues and international intellectual property rights. Professor Abbott’s research has been published in leading medical, legal, and scientific journals.



Professor Abbott has worked as General Counsel and Medical Director of a mid-stage biotechnology company, and has served as a consultant for international organizations, academic institutions and non-profit enterprises including the World Health Organization and the World Intellectual Property Organization. 



Professor Abbott is a licensed and board certified physician, attorney, and acupuncturist in the United States. He is a graduate of the University of California, San Diego School of Medicine (M.D.) and the Yale Law School (J.D.), as well as a Summa Cum Laude graduate from Emperor's College (M.T.O.M.) and a Summa Cum Laude graduate from University of California, Los Angeles (B.S.). Professor Abbott has been the recipient of numerous research fellowships, scholarships and awards, and has served as Principal Investigator of clinical research studies at the University of California. He is a registered patent attorney with the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office and a member of the California and New York State Bars.
